Web... 9.2 If the service is delivered when the receiving player or pair is not ready, provided that neither the receiver nor his partner attempts to strike the ball. This rule is self-explanatory: the rally is not scored. As no point has been awarded, service will not change, so the serving player must serve again. WebServer and Receiver: The “server” is the player due to strike the ball first in a rally. The “receiver” is the player due to strike the ball second in a rally. Strike and Volley: A player “strikes” the ball if they touch it with their racket, held in the hand, or with their racket-hand below the wrist. WebReceiver – The player who is returning the first strike from the server. Game – Won when a player first scores 11 points and leads by at least 2 points. WebIn this tutorial, we will be looking at how to perform a forehand pendulum backspin / sidespin serve in table tennis. As a more advanced serve, the idea is to prevent the receiver from making a strong attack against the serve, and hopefully force a weak return instead that can be third ball attacked.
